> I have the DOS 3.3 FST installed, how come I can't format the 5.25's as
> DOS 3.3?
The DOS 3.3 FST is read only. It was mostly designed for bring data
into ProDOS or GS/OS from your old DOS 3.3 disks.
> Can you use Dos 3.3 on the apple//gs?
Yep...at heart, it's still an Apple II, just have to boot the floppy
usually.
